What they do

An Automotive Service Technician or Mechanic repairs and performs maintenance on cars and smaller trucks; may conduct auto inspections.

$49,475 / year median in Illinois

+7% projected growth

Up to $100,000+ Annually About the Opportunity We are seeking an experienced A-Level or B-Level Automotive Technician to join a busy, family-owned repair shop in DeKalb, Illinois. This opportunity is ideal for a technician with strong diagnostic and repair skills who enjoys working in a professional, team-oriented environment with consistent workflow and opportunities for growth. Enjoy a Monday-Friday schedule with no weekends , competitive hourly pay plus commission, ongoing training, and a workplace that values quality workmanship and technician development. Key Responsibilities Perform brake, tire, and wheel alignment services Diagnose and repair drivetrain and drivability concerns Perform engine repairs and routine maintenance Complete Digital Vehicle Inspections (DVIs) on every vehicle Communicate repair findings clearly with service advisors and team members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work environment Deliver high-quality repairs while maintaining productivity Qualifications Three or more years of professional automotive repair experience Strong diagnostic and repair skills Ability to work independently while maintaining productivity Experience performing Digital Vehicle Inspections (DVIs) Ability to safely lift and move up to 100 pounds Strong communication skills Professional, dependable, and team-oriented Compensation & Benefits $30-$40 per hour plus commission Annual earning potential up to $100,000+ Health insurance Vision insurance Short-term disability insurance Paid Time Off Paid training and certifications Simple IRA with 3% employer match Team events Consistent workflow in a high-volume shop Why Work Here Monday-Friday schedule with no weekend work Busy, family-owned repair shop with a loyal customer base Consistent workflow and steady hours Clean, organized facility Supportive ownership and collaborative team environment Ongoing investment in technician training and career development Opportunity to increase your skills and earning potential Apply today to learn more about this opportunity to join a respected automotive repair shop in DeKalb, IL and continue building your automotive career.
